" A very social accommodation however it really needed decorating as some of the kitchen ceiling was falling down and only had a very small window and there wasn’t enough ventilation. The rooms are very small however there is a lot of storage space. The carpet definitely needs changing however "

" Great halls for a social life and located extremely close to the university and city centre. You do share a kitchen with 12 people which can be messy and difficult but the large numbers was great for a sociable freshers year. "

" I have mixed opinions about this place. I don't regret moving there and I many memories as well as friends. However, for the whole year I lived there I was extremely anxious and uncomfortable. there are too many people in the flat, which may be good during freshers but horrible when uni starts to get serious from January. the best thing is its location. the rooms are tiny and the walls are extremely thin. " The common room was really big and good for socialising. However, sharing the flat with a lot of people, which is not always easy. But the common areas were clean most of the time. The fridge was nearly always overstuffed. "
